Transaction e23ccb9140f2ec0ee6232ac9c73f7c79ee853aa384d2595dd678bc3900416207
1 Input
1 Output
-
e23ccb9140f2ec0ee6232ac9c73f7c79ee853aa384d2595dd678bc3900416207:0
- value
- 923344
- script pubkey
- OP_0 OP_PUSHBYTES_20 637dc78506af4edf218aea81db292e90d660f99f
- address
- bc1qvd7u0pgx4a8d7gv2a2qak2fwjrtxp7vl9ufrue